Sorts Of Scaffolding



Although scaffolding systems can differ widely in style and application, they generally drop right into several distinctive categories that deal with different building demands - Scaffolding. The most common kinds consist of supported scaffolding, suspended scaffolding, and rolling scaffolding


Sustained scaffolding consists of platforms sustained by a structure of poles, which supply a stable and elevated working surface. This kind is typically utilized for jobs that require considerable altitude, such as bricklaying or external paint.




Put on hold scaffolding, on the other hand, is made use of for tasks calling for accessibility to high altitudes, such as cleansing or fixing structure exteriors. This system hangs from a roof or an additional framework, permitting employees to reduced or elevate the system as required.


Rolling scaffolding functions wheels that enable simple movement across a work website. It is specifically valuable for jobs that call for regular relocation, such as interior operate in large rooms.


Each kind of scaffolding is made with certain applications in mind, making certain that building and construction jobs can be performed efficiently and efficiently. Understanding these groups is critical for picking the proper scaffolding system to satisfy both project needs and website conditions.


Key Safety And Security Attributes



Security is paramount in scaffolding systems, as the prospective risks related to operating at heights can lead to severe mishaps if not effectively handled. Key safety and security functions are necessary to ensure the wellness of workers and the honesty of the building website.


Primarily, guardrails are essential. These obstacles offer a physical safeguard against drops, dramatically lowering the danger of major injuries. In addition, toe boards are often used to stop devices and materials from dropping off the scaffold, safeguarding employees below.




One more vital element is using non-slip surfaces on platforms. This attribute enhances hold, specifically in unfavorable weather, thus decreasing the possibility of drops and slips. Moreover, accessibility ladders should be safely placed to promote safe entrance and departure from the scaffold.


Routine assessments and upkeep of scaffolding systems are additionally crucial. These assessments ensure that all elements remain in great problem and operating appropriately, addressing any wear or damages immediately.


Last but not least, correct training for all employees involved in scaffolding operations is necessary to guarantee that they comprehend security procedures and can determine potential risks. Product Advancements



Improvements in material science have actually substantially influenced the scaffolding market, enhancing both safety and performance in modern building. The introduction of high-strength steel and light weight aluminum alloys has actually reinvented typical scaffolding systems. These products are not just lighter, making them simpler to carry and put together, but additionally supply remarkable load-bearing capabilities. This causes scaffolding frameworks that can support better weights while lessening the risk of collapse.


Furthermore, cutting-edge composite materials, such as fiberglass-reinforced plastics, have actually emerged as sensible alternatives. These products are immune to rust and ecological degradation, hence extending the life expectancy of scaffolding systems, particularly in extreme weather conditions. The usage of such materials contributes to decrease maintenance expenses and makes certain consistent efficiency with time.

Maintenance and Examinations



The efficiency of scaffolding systems extends past preliminary design and execution; continuous maintenance and normal assessments are important to guaranteeing their continued efficiency and security throughout the duration of a task. Regular examinations must be conducted by certified workers to recognize any type of signs of wear, damages, or instability that could endanger the integrity of the scaffolding.


Upkeep protocols must include regular checks of structural elements, such as installations, planks, and structures, ensuring that all aspects continue to be totally free and safe and secure from corrosion or other damage. Additionally, the performance of safety and security features, such as guardrails and toe boards, need to be analyzed to ensure compliance with safety and security regulations.


Documentation of all assessments and upkeep tasks is vital for accountability and governing conformity. An organized technique to record-keeping not just help in tracking the problem of the scaffolding yet additionally gives necessary evidence in the event of an incident.


Eventually, developing a detailed upkeep and examination schedule will considerably minimize the danger of crashes and boost the total safety and security of the building and construction website. By focusing on these techniques, building and construction supervisors can guard employees and promote the task's honesty.
